Tost believes that Gasly would have deserved Perez’s place at Red Bull
Franz Tost, who has retired and left his position as team principal at AlphaTauri, has explained that he would have preferred to see Pierre Gasly return to Red Bull, instead of the hiring of Sergio Perez.

Franz Tost has had Pierre Gasly under his command at AlphaTauri for four seasons, from 2019 to 2022. For him, the appointment of the Mexican driver is seen as a disapproval, especially since Gasly had just won his first Grand Prix with Racing Point.
« Mateschitz told me from the beginning that he cannot afford to have two teams fighting for the title. AlphaTauri’s role is solely to benefit from synergies with Red Bull Racing and coach the drivers, says Franz Tost.
Tost has never changed his way of doing things in Formula 1, training the young drivers in his team. The goal is to allow them to perform for AlphaTauri, but also to reach the heights in F1. For him, Gasly clearly had what it takes to be worthy of Red Bull, especially after being replaced once before in a rather quick manner, after 12 races in 2019.
« Training young people has always been clear to me. I have always been happy and satisfied when my drivers got a seat at Red Bull. However, I have had difficulty accepting that Red Bull chose Sergio Perez instead of Pierre Gasly, for example », he continues.
« I appreciated when they recruited our drivers because it means that the team has done a good job. It was good to see Red Bull’s drivers winning races and championships. I know that on our side, we do not have the necessary infrastructure to win races legitimately, » concludes Franz Tost.
